What is a DRESS CODE???

Its a set of rules specifying the correct manner of dress while on the premises of the institution (or specifying what manner of dress is prohibited) and guess what we have a dress code here it is liberal in Dubai compared to other Middle Eastern cities, particularly in the residential western expat areas where women wear shorts and sleeveless shirts. However, Abu Dhabi is more conservative than Dubai and as a mark of respect it is advisable for women to dress accordingly. Long skirts or long trousers, and T-shirts or shirts with sleeves covering at least the upper arm should be worn in Abu Dhabi, and any area in the United Arab Emirates that is predominantly Arab. (I dont see that) Men may dress casually in the western expat areas, but should wear long pants when in Abu Dhabi or the downtown area of Dubai. The dress code is less formal for children, although adolescent girls would be advised to dress moderately in order to avoid attention. Both local men and local women are easily distinguished by their traditional dress, which is a common sight in the United Arab Emirates. Men wear the long white Dishdasha and headdress, while women wear the black Abaya.

 How can I tell the difference between being depressed or just being in a down, funky mood? I read the answer for this question somwhere it said that the first step is to understand depression. "Depression" is not a choice. It's like an ongoing state of being totally bummed out, and you can't just snap out of it. Many things can trigger it, like the:
 
  1.  Death of someone close
  2.  Unhealthy relationships
  3. Family financial difficulties
  4. Being the victim of any kind of abuse

 

Therefore depression is an illness, and because it is an illness, it is treatable. In most cases, you can get rid of it with medicine that keeps neurotransmitters (chemicals in the brain that affect moods) in check. Going to talk-therapy with a professional therapist is another form of helpful treatment.

Friday-Saturday weekend in UAE

 
Hiya
 
 
 
In September the UAE's official weekend will be Friday and Saturday. All public sector establishments as well as government and private schools will adopt the new weekend in place of the present Thursday-Friday.
